TRAC Intermodal is North America’s leading intermodal equipment provider and chassis pool manager serving domestic and international shippers. The company's operations include long-term leasing and short-term rentals of the approximately 272,000 chassis in our fleet. We also provide pool/fleet management services and are a leader in providing chassis solutions to the intermodal industry that are designed to increase supply chain efficiency, control costs and promote safety.

The Essentials
We are North America’s leading intermodal equipment provider and chassis pool manager servicing domestic and international shippers.

Largest Fleet of Chassis in North America – Over 309,000 chassis under management; with 202,000 in the marine segment, 75,000 in the domestic segment and 32,000 in inventory.
Broad National Footprint –563 marine pool locations, 152 domestic pool locations, and 61 Depots.
Market Share Leader –Over 37 percent of the marine and domestic chassis market in North America.
Extensive Pool Management– Ten neutral marine pools and North America’s only national domestic pool.
Best-In-Class Technology Platform – PoolStat provides chassis tracking and billing in neutral pools and is a central operating database.
Experienced Management Team –More than 135 total years of experience. Past senior management employment includes FedEx, CSX, Deutsche Post DHL, Pacer, and Transamerica.
Satisfies Customer Needs– High quality, road-able chassis in the right place at the right time. Delivers new products that meet customer needs.
